YAN v. GONZALES

No. 05-9564.

438 F.3d 1249 (2006)

Yong Ting YAN, Petitioner, v. Alberto R. GONZALES, Attorney General, Respondent.

United States Court of Appeals, Tenth Circuit.

March 2, 2006.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Submitted on the briefs: Yong Ting Yan, Pro Se, Petitioner.

Peter D. Keisler, Assistant Attorney General, Civil Division, Greg D. Mack, Senior Litigation Counsel, Office of Immigration Litigation, Thomas M. Gannon, Attorney, Appellate Section, Criminal Division, Department of Justice, Washington, D.C., for Respondent.

Before McCONNELL, ANDERSON, and BALDOCK, Circuit Judges.


McCONNELL, Circuit Judge.

Pro se petitioner Yong Ting Yan seeks review of a final order of removal issued by the Bureau of Immigration Appeals (BIA), which summarily affirmed a determination by an Immigration Judge (IJ) denying Mr. Yan's application for asylum, restriction on removal,1 and the Convention Against Torture (CAT). We reverse the decision of the BIA, and remand for further proceedings...
